Jhamatpur

Jhamatpur is a village in Ketugram II CD block in Katwa subdivision of Purba Bardhaman district, West Bengal, India It is near Ketugram, 4 km east of Jhamatpur-Baharanpur, 157 km north from Howrah Station, on the B.A.K.

Jhamatpur Baharan railway station serves nearby areas.

As per the 2011 Census of India Jhamatpur had a total population of 1,543, of which 794 (51%) were males and 749 (49%) were females.

The Vaishnav tradition is still maintained by different socio-cultural programs throughout the year, specially the famous Nama-kirtana accompanying feast for several days after Durgapuja.
